Match Commentary

  • 23': VAR Decision: Penalty Boavista.
  • 24': Goal! Boavista 1, Estoril Praia 0. Gustavo Sauer (Boavista) converts the penalty with a left footed shot to the bottom left corner.
  • 45'+2': Kenji Gorré (Boavista) is shown the yellow card for a bad foul.
  • 45': Second Half begins Boavista 1, Estoril Praia 0.
  • 66': Substitution, Boavista. Paul-Georges Ntep replaces Kenji Gorré.
  • 67': Substitution, Estoril Praia. António Xavier replaces Arthur Gomes.
  • 67': Substitution, Estoril Praia. André Franco replaces João Gamboa.
  • 68': Chiquinho (Estoril Praia) is shown the yellow card for a bad foul.
  • 71': Goal! Boavista 1, Estoril Praia 1. André Franco (Estoril Praia) left footed shot from the centre of the box to the high centre of the goal. Assisted by Francisco Geraldes with a cross following a corner.
  • 74': Substitution, Boavista. Ilija Vukotic replaces Sebastián Pérez.
  • 76': Filipe Ferreira (Boavista) is shown the yellow card for a bad foul.
  • 82': Substitution, Boavista. Tomás Reymão replaces Gaïus Makouta.
  • 82': Substitution, Boavista. Yusupha Om Njie replaces Petar Musa.
  • 86': Substitution, Estoril Praia. André Clóvis replaces Rui Fonte.
  • 87': Joãozinho (Estoril Praia) is shown the yellow card for a bad foul.
  • 90'+1': Substitution, Estoril Praia. Romário Baró replaces Francisco Geraldes.
  • 90'+2': Substitution, Estoril Praia. Bruno Lourenço replaces Chiquinho.
  • 90'+6': Alireza Safar Beiranvand (Boavista) is shown the yellow card.
